Jean Baptiste Raguenet's masterpiece, "The Festival of Sailors in the Seine," captures the lively spirit of an 18th-century outdoor celebration in Paris. Painted in oil on canvas, this detailed work of art is a vibrant and colorful depiction of a festival taking place along the banks of the Seine River. The sun casts a warm glow over the scene, illuminating the faces of the joyous crowd as they gather to celebrate. At the heart of the composition, a group of sailors, dressed in their best attire, are seen raising a toast to the day. Their laughter and camaraderie are palpable, as they raise their glasses in a toast to the sea and to each other. The scene is filled with a sense of community and unity, as people from all walks of life come together to enjoy the festivities. The intricate details of the painting are truly breathtaking. The rich colors and textures of the clothing, the rippling water of the Seine, and the intricate patterns of the boats all come to life under Raguenet's skilled brush. The horizontal composition and the abundance of natural light add to the sense of spaciousness and openness, making this a truly captivating work of art. This painting is a treasure of French cultural heritage and is currently housed in the Musée Carnavalet in Paris.
